What type of plastic is dirt bike plastics?

HOW A PIECE OF PLASTIC IS MADE: Polypropylene is fed into a heated barrel. Materials are mixed, raised to a temperature of 400 degrees Fahrenheit, and pushed through a rod into a mold. It takes around 200 seconds for a piece of plastic to be formed.

Can you PlasticWeld PVC?

Virtually all of thermoplastics exhibit excellent weldability and PVC is no exception . The welding process involves applying sufficient heat to melt the PVC coating, then applying pressure and cooling to form a weld. Welding techniques are mostly differentiated by how the heat is generated and applied.

Does Gorilla Glue bond plastic to plastic?

Gorilla Glue doesn’t work well on plastic . It’s an adhesive that works by creating a chemical bond using moisture, allowing it to expand into both surfaces. Since plastic isn’t permeable, the glue can’t create a strong bond between the plastic and another surface.

Which type of plastic is used in bikes?

Materials. Acrylonitrile butadiene styrene (ABS) plastic is commonly used in original equipment sport bikes and certain aftermarket fairing manufacturers due to its strong, flexible and light weight properties.

What are MX plastics made of?

Moreover, what type of plastic is dirt bike plastics? ATV fenders typically consist of polyethylene (PE) and polypropylene (PP) materials. Polyethylene and polypropylene are considered oily plastic materials, or olefinic plastic materials.
